Synopsis

In 1897 Britain, H. George Wells is leading the nation into a technological golden age — until a beautiful woman abducts him at gunpoint. Jane Robbins, a spy, infiltrates Wells's house to deliver him to her employer, hoping to halt what she sees as an oncoming authoritarian Utopia.

Jane has her reasons to fear the future Wells is building, but she is drawn to him regardless, even as their opposing convictions push them apart. She must choose between saving the man she is falling for and sacrificing him to the cause.

Stealing Utopia is Tilda Booth's debut, a short steampunk romance full of gadgets, guns, death rays and dirigibles, published under the Silk, Steel and Steam banner.
